Denture wearers can talk and eat normally after 15 to 30 days of wearing their new dentures. To reduce any displacement of the false teeth, patients should try to bite their teeth and swallow before speaking. If the teeth move when talking, it is essential to put them back in the correct position. Denture adhesive can also help to reduce displacement, as many types keep the teeth in place all day long.

The next step in terms of denture support, jaw health preservation and cost is to place up to 8 implants in each arch, which can then support a fixed denture or a removable denture. With the dentures attached to the implant, it offers an experience much like having real teeth and you never have to worry about them moving when you talk, eat or kiss. All-On-Four eliminates dirty dental adhesive, white plaster on the lips and the discomfort of removable dentures.
